The association between ibuprofen administration in children and the risk of developing or exacerbating asthma: a systematic review and meta-analysis

Luke Baxter,
Maria M Cobo,
Aomesh Bhatt
et al.

Abstract: Background Ibuprofen is one of the most commonly used analgesic and antipyretic drugs in children. However, its potential causal role in childhood asthma pathogenesis remains uncertain. In this systematic review, we assessed the association between ibuprofen administration in children and the risk of developing or exacerbating asthma.
